ボタンクリックとjstree
作成クリックで、プログラムでcontextmenu
に新しいノードを追加しようとしていますが、いくつかの問題があります。
ここ はフィドルのリンクです。
<div id="jstree">
</div>
<button id="sam">create node</button>
これがあなたのフィドルで、動作するように修正されています: http://jsfiddle.net/3q9Ma/223/
配列を使用してcreate_node
を呼び出していましたが、これは間違っていました。また、文字列値'null'
はルートノードを作成する正しい方法ではありませんでした。特別な文字列値'#'
を使用してください(以降のバージョンでは) null
も機能しますが、文字列としては機能しません)。
Jstreeバージョンのアップグレードを検討するかもしれません-あなたのフィドルは非常に初期のベータを使用していました。また、jstree自体はAngularを必要としないことに注意してください。